The reason behind my choice of picking this as my vignette was that it was a
memory in life that I hold close because of the extraordinary opportunity it was
to be there. To gain the full aspect of why it's such an once in a life time
experience is because for one time only in a year the greatest active baseball
players come together in one game at Yankee stadium. Also along with that is
that every year the MLB All Star game takes place in different cities and the
last time it happened in Yankee stadium was July 19, 1977.
"The one gadget that I had brought to capture the unique moments of this event was in no position to work. I
thought to myself regarding the fact that I could not capture these amazing
moments I had the privilege to actually be at the game and experience it at
first hand. Above the stadium hung huge structures that included circular metal
plates with huge bulbs that lit the stadium up. From top to bottom the stadium
was filled with fans anxious for the game to commence. The large screen hanging
from the opposite side of the stadium projecting the player introductions. The
highly anticipated introduction of the hometown players was outstanding. When
Jeter walked on that field the stadium sparked up like a flame, hundreds of
camera flashes went off. The ceremony ended with B2 stealth bomber flying over
the stadium. I might not have had the flash to capture the memory but the
experience from first person point of view seemed like the better gain."
